Understanding Engine Parts and Problems
Knowledge of your car's mechanical components is crucial for maintaining ideal performance and minimizing repair expenses. Let's focus on key engine parts and typical problems.
The engine block functions as the core component that contains the cylinders where fuel ignition happens. These cylindrical pistons change fuel energy to mechanical energy. The crankshaft then transforms this vertical motion into rotating energy, propelling your vehicle.
The valvetrain serves a vital function in regulating the coordination of intake processes and managing exhaust gas release. This incorporates a complex system of camshafts, valves, and springs, maintaining efficient engine operation.
Common engine problems can appear in multiple ways. Starting issues often indicate electrical or fuel delivery problems—examine the battery, starter motor, and fuel pump.
Operating problems like rough running or misfiring may be caused by worn spark plugs, clogged fuel injectors, or damaged oxygen sensors.
Overheating is another frequent concern, generally due to failing water pumps, coolant leaks, or malfunctioning thermostats. Pay attention to symptoms like unusual noises or visible signs such as unusual exhaust fumes.
Scheduled upkeep, including regular air filter changes and oil replacements, is essential for avoiding these problems.
Understanding Transmission and Drivetrain
Understanding the intricacies of your vehicle's transmission and drivetrain is crucial to maintaining seamless power delivery and overall performance. The powertrain, encompassing both engine and drivetrain, converts the engine's energy into controlled movement.
Fundamental to this system, the transmission controls power delivery, a two main types: manual, requiring clutch and gear input, and automatic, which independently handles gear changes via hydraulic systems.
When considering automatic transmissions, the torque converter plays a critical role by linking the engine to the transmission. It improves torque output through vortex power rotation, making certain energy is transferred efficiently.
The driveshaft, made from resilient materials like aluminum or steel, relays rotational force from the transmission to the differential, utilizing constant-velocity joints for seamless operation.
Grasping the differential is crucial; it permits wheels to rotate at different speeds during turns, preserving power delivery, especially in vehicles with multiple driven wheels.
Axles connect the wheels to the differential, differing in configuration based on vehicle design.
To ensure optimal performance, periodic inspection and maintenance of these components are essential, improving fuel efficiency and stopping costly repairs.
Understanding Brake Maintenance
Understanding the sophisticated world of brake system maintenance guarantees both performance and safety on the road. Your vehicle's brake system is a complex array of elements including brake pads, rotors, calipers, brake lines, and fluid. Every element requires careful monitoring for maximum functionality.

Regular inspections, optimally performed yearly or more often according to your driving conditions, are crucial for early problem detection.
Brake fluid maintenance is critical as it accumulates moisture, causing reduced efficiency and corrosion. Refresh it every 24-36 months or 30,000 miles. In addition, monitor brake pads—they deteriorate naturally and typically need replacement between 25,000 and 70,000 miles.
Be alert to warning signs like unusual noises—like squealing, grinding, or metal-on-metal sounds—and symptoms like a spongy brake pedal, vehicle pulling to one side, pedal vibrations, or extended stopping distances. These signals warrant prompt service from a professional technician.
Regular maintenance involves monthly brake fluid inspections and pad thickness assessments. Additionally, practice smooth braking habits and refrain from riding the brakes.
Understanding Suspension and Steering Parts
Understanding the complex elements of suspension and steering is essential for maintaining your vehicle's performance and safety. Your suspension system depends on multiple springs—such as coil, leaf, torsion bars, and air—to support the vehicle's weight and absorb impacts.

Dampening elements including struts, shock absorbers, bushings, and control arms manage wheel motion and reduce vibration. Together, these components steady your ride, improving driving dynamics.
In steering, critical elements include the column, steering wheel, tie rods, rack and pinion, and ball joints. Power assist systems—whether electric, hydraulic, or hybrid—provide essential assistance, making steering smoother and more accurate.
Recognizing signs of issues is vital. If you detect excessive bouncing, uneven tire wear, or difficulty steering, these could indicate suspension or steering concerns.
Routine inspections are essential. Check shock absorbers, bushings, and power steering fluid levels routinely. Resolve any strange sounds or vehicle pulling without delay.
Routine alignment checks and lubrication of moving parts can prevent long-term damage. By comprehending and maintaining these systems, you ensure consistent road contact, predictable braking, and a smoother driving experience, finally improving your vehicle's safety and overall performance.
Automotive Electrical System Analysis
Delving into the intricacies of your vehicle's electrical system is crucial in maintaining optimal functionality and reliability. Modern vehicles rely heavily on these systems for everything from engine control to entertainment, making diagnostics a fundamental requirement.
Start with the essential tools: a multimeter for measuring circuit values; electronic diagnostic devices for reading fault codes; and scope meters for analyzing electrical waveforms.
Start diagnostics by gathering information about symptoms and visually inspecting components for physical defects. A systematic approach begins with a battery health check, continuing with charging system verification and ground connection verification.
Fuse and relay checks are essential to detect any current flow issues. Typical concerns often involve the ignition system, such as battery troubles or cranking system malfunctions, and alternator problems like alternator and voltage regulation problems.
Advanced techniques, like waveform interpretation and parasitic draw testing, help unravel complex issues. For computer system diagnostics, validate ECU communication and monitoring system operation are intact.
Regular upkeep, including terminal corrosion prevention and wire harness inspections, is essential. Seek professional help for complex or safety-related problems, keeping service records to identify repeated failures and ensure complete fixes.

ASE Certification Overview
Selecting an experienced auto repair shop may seem daunting, but understanding ASE certification simplifies your selection. ASE certification, granted by the National Institute for Automotive Service Excellence, represents the automotive industry's benchmark for technician expertise.
While looking for a repair facility, look for the blue ASE seal and technicians wearing ASE patches. These credentials verify that the technicians have achieved strict standards through extensive testing in specific areas such as brake systems, engine work, and electrical components.
Technicians obtain ASE certification by finishing two years of on-the-job training or combining one year of experience with a two-year automotive degree, before passing specific exams. To keep certification, they must recertify every five years, confirming they remain current on the latest automotive technology.
This dedication to continuous education assures that certified technicians can competently troubleshoot and fix modern vehicles' complex systems.
Master ASE Certification goes beyond, requiring technicians to complete multiple tests across various specialties, proving their complete expertise.

Essential Maintenance Guidelines
Your vehicle's longevity can be greatly increased through a carefully structured maintenance approach.
Implement scheduled service intervals every 5,000 to 8,000 miles or approximately twice yearly. Basic maintenance covers filter and oil replacement, checking fluid levels, rotating tires, and routine examinations.
When reaching 15,000 miles, conduct intermediate services with complete car examinations and replace transmission fluid and air filters. At 30,000 miles, tackle major services like spark plug and brake fluid replacement, along with differential oil and cabin air filter changes.
Proper fluid care is crucial. Periodically refresh engine oil between 5,000 and 8,000 miles.
Replace transmission fluid every 30,000 miles to prevent wear. Change brake fluid every two years or 25,000 miles, and refresh cooling fluid every two years or 30,000 miles to prevent overheating.
Follow filter replacement guidelines: Engine air filters every 15,000 miles and change cabin air filters every 30,000 miles.
Change oil filters with every engine oil replacement.
For tire maintenance, rotate tires at 5,000-8,000 mile intervals, perform annual alignment checks, and monitor tire pressure monthly.
Frequently check battery connections for corrosion, monitor performance, and maintain clean terminals to maintain consistent function.

Consumer Protection and Rights
Steering through the realm of auto repairs can be complex, but being aware of your consumer rights guarantees you're protected. Auto repair statutes compel shops to furnish written estimates for repairs exceeding $100, requiring your approval before extra work. They cannot legally exceed the estimated costs by more than 10% without your explicit consent.
Be sure to look for your rights posted prominently at the shop, including the option to inspect replaced parts and review your vehicle before payment.
Warranties are crucial. Repair shops must extend a minimum 90-day or 3,000-mile warranty on repairs and parts unless explicitly noted differently. Confirm the warranty terms are recorded, outlining coverage limits, duration, and claim procedures.
If problems occur, start with direct communication—send a complaint and ask for a response within 14 days. If not settled, look into alternative dispute resolutions like the BBB AUTO LINE or state agencies. Legal action should be your final option.
Feel free to obtain a second opinion. Compare shop estimates, warranties, and certifications. Verify the shop's track record with complaints to validate quality assurance.
